首页 > 解决方案 > 在 Thymeleaf 中获取带有参数的完整 URL?

问题描述

我在 Spring Boot 服务器上有一个分页的汽车列表,其中包含用于过滤和排序的参数 sort、range、desc、page 等,并在 Thymeleaf 中生成如下所示的 URL:

example.com/cars?page=5&sort=mileage

我希望能够使用其中一些参数向 URL 添加更多参数,但我对此很陌生,并且真的不知道如何使用所有参数获取当前 URL 以添加更多参数而不会丢失以前的看起来像

example.com/cars?page=5&sort=mileage&desc=true

我找到了在 Spring 上执行此类操作的答案,但理想情况下希望在 Thymeleaf 模板上执行此操作,这可能吗?

获取包含所有参数的完整当前 url thymeleaf

我发现你可以使用 ${param.sort} 来获取 Thymeleaf 中的特定参数来获取参数排序,类似的东西可以获取当前的所有参数吗?

谢谢

标签: springthymeleaf

解决方案


推荐阅读